The cheapest way to get from Abertillery to Potters Bar is to bus and subway which costs £26 - £50 and takes 6h 30m.
The fastest way to get from Abertillery to Potters Bar is to drive which takes 2h 59m and costs £35 - £60.
The distance between Abertillery and Potters Bar is 175 miles. The road distance is 160 miles.
The best way to get from Abertillery to Potters Bar without a car is to bus and train which takes 4h 29m and costs £65 - £170.
It takes approximately 4h 29m to get from Abertillery to Potters Bar,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Abertillery to Potters Bar is 160 miles. It takes approximately 2h 59m to drive from Abertillery to Potters Bar.
